I've been trying to create an array of points (in Squeak 5) but am failing
badly. See below: first part => what I get when I exec "print it" on the
first part. Guidance please.
#(1@1 2@2) => #(1 #@ 1 2 #@ 2)
#((Point x: 1 y: 1) (Point x: 2 y: 2)) => #(#(#Point #x: 1 #y: 1) #(#Point
#x: 2 #y:
